What Is Sleep Apnea and How Does It Work?
Rest apnea is a condition in which your breathing repetitively stops and begins while you're asleep. These stops can last just a few secs or stretch to a min or even more, happening lots or even thousands of times an evening. Your brain detects the absence of oxygen and briefly wakes you up so that regular breathing can return to. Commonly, these awakenings are so short that you don't remember them. Yet the result is an evening of fragmented, poor-quality rest that leaves you really feeling drained pipes the next day.
There are various forms of rest apnea, with the most common being obstructive rest apnea. This takes place when the muscles in the rear of your throat fail to keep your respiratory tract open. Central rest apnea, though less usual, includes the brain falling short to send out the proper signals to the muscles that control breathing.
Subtle Signs That Point to a Bigger Problem
One of the trickiest aspects of sleep apnea is exactly how simple it is to miss out on. Many individuals think of loud snoring as the main symptom, and while snoring is common, it's much from the only indication. Actually, some individuals with rest apnea don't snore in any way. That's why it's so crucial to take notice of the extra subtle signs that your body might be offering you.
Awakening with a completely dry mouth or sore throat, morning headaches, and sensation exceedingly sleepy during the day are all signals that something could be off. If you find yourself sleeping during job meetings, at the wheel, or even while seeing television, it could be a sign that your rest is being interrupted more often than you assume.
You may also see mood adjustments, problem concentrating, or a short temper. These signs and symptoms are commonly written off as the outcome of tension or a busy routine, but persistent sleep starvation triggered by rest apnea can take a real toll on your psychological health.
Just how It Affects Your Body Beyond Sleep
The consequences of untreated rest apnea go far past daytime sleepiness. With time, this condition can cause serious health and wellness issues. Disrupted breathing emphasizes the cardiovascular system and has actually been connected to high blood pressure, heart problem, stroke, and also type 2 diabetic issues. It can also compromise the body immune system, making you more prone to health problem and slower to recover.

When to Take Action and What to Expect
So, when should you take that sixth sense seriously and speak to an expert? If any of the signs and symptoms explained over noise familiar, it's worth having a discussion with an expert. A rest research study-- either at a clinic or in the convenience of your home-- can assist determine if rest apnea is the cause of your exhaustion.
Treatment alternatives vary based upon the seriousness of the problem. Some people benefit from way of living changes, such as losing weight or changing rest positions. Others might require more organized interventions, such as oral devices or continuous positive respiratory tract pressure (CPAP) therapy to maintain the respiratory tract open during sleep. It's not a one-size-fits-all circumstance, and locating the best option can significantly enhance lifestyle.
